Ebru ÖZTÜRKMEN from Gaziantep İpekyolu Development Agency and a delegation of 10 people visited TÜBİTAK MAM on July 13, 2015. The delegation, accompanied by TÜBİTAK MAM Business Development Unit, visited the Institute of Materials and the Institute of Chemical Technology. During the laboratory visits, general information about the working areas of the Institutes was provided and detailed information about the studies and projects carried out in the Institutes was given to the delegation by the experts on site. The visit was deemed useful in terms of introducing our Center, providing information about the work carried out and exploring potential cooperation.
